WC2E 7HG is an up-and-coming urban area on Southampton Street, 0.1km from The Strand in City of Westminster. Administratively it sits within St James's ward and the Cities of London and Westminster constituency.

This is a well-established rental postcode — a young professional neighbourhood — career-focused, mobile, mostly renting. The daytime character shifts — high status city commuters, mostly in london. An average age of 33 points to a young professional and early-career population — ambitious, mobile, and predominantly renting. 80% of homes are privately rented — a strong rental market with good supply for incoming tenants. Employment levels are high (55% in full-time work) — a well-connected, economically active community.

Safety: Crime rates are high (1117 per 1,000 residents) — commercial zones and transport hubs in the vicinity contribute to these figures. Property: Prices average £1.0M, down 63.6% year-on-year. The Index of Multiple Deprivation places this area in the most deprived 20% nationally — this often means more affordable prices and active local authority investment, but also fewer amenities and higher benefit dependency.

Census 2021 statistics for WC2E 7HG are sourced from Output Area E00190454 (shared with 277 postcodes in this micro-neighbourhood). Property prices come from HM Land Registry.
